Speaker Bio:
 
Scott Sommer is a member of the Four Peaks Rotary Club in Fountain Hills, Arizona, where he has served since joining in 2016. His commitment to Rotary’s mission of service and leadership is reflected in his tenure as Club President, a role he held for nearly two and a half years. He now continues his service as President of the Four Peaks Rotary Foundation, providing strategic oversight and stewardship for the club’s philanthropic initiatives.
 
At the district level, Scott plays an active and influential role in advancing Rotary’s long‑term vision and operational excellence. He currently serves as an Assistant Governor, initially supporting the Flagstaff, Williams, and Grand Canyon Clubs. In July 2026, he will
transition to supporting three additional clubs in the Valley. Scott also serves on the District Strategic Planning Committee and the District Finance Committee, contributing to district‑wide governance, fiscal responsibility, and organizational development. In addition, he chairs the District Visioning for Clubs program, guiding clubs through structured planning processes that strengthen their identity, clarify priorities, and support sustainable growth.
 
Professionally, Scott is a private consultant specializing in the design and implementation of service‑delivery programs across multiple business sectors. Rotary at a Glance

Rotary brings together a global network of volunteer leaders who dedicate their time and talent to tackle the world’s most pressing humanitarian challenges. Rotary connects 1.2 million members from more than 200 countries and geographical areas. Their work impacts lives at both the local and international levels.
